La experiencia de encender tu equipo, iniciar tu sistema operativo y que el sonido, simplemente, no funcione, es una de las frustraciones tecnológicas más comunes y desesperantes. Más aún si eres un fiel usuario de Ubuntu 12.04 LTS-2 Precise Pangolin, una versión que, a pesar de su antigüedad, sigue siendo apreciada por muchos por su probada estabilidad y fiabilidad. Si te encuentras en este barco, donde el silencio se ha apoderado de tus auriculares y altavoces, no estás solo. Esta guía exhaustiva está diseñada para devolver la melodía a tu vida digital, abordando cada posible causa de pérdida de audio en esta venerable distribución.
Sabemos que la tecnología avanza a pasos agigantados, y mantenerse en una versión como Ubuntu 12.04 LTS-2 puede parecer inusual para algunos. Sin embargo, existen múltiples razones de peso para ello. Quizás tengas un sistema heredado que depende de software específico ya no compatible con versiones más recientes, o tal vez simplemente prefieres la interfaz Unity original y el entorno de aquella época. Quizás eres un purista que valora la estabilidad probada de una Long Term Support (LTS) o utilizas hardware que funciona perfectamente con los controladores de Precise Pangolin. Sea cual sea tu motivo, tu decisión merece respeto y, sobre todo, soluciones funcionales para tus desafíos tecnológicos. Uno de los más persistentes, y a menudo el más molesto, es la ausencia de sonido.
Desentrañando el Sonido en Linux: Una Breve Visión Técnica 🧠
Antes de sumergirnos en las soluciones, es útil entender cómo funciona el sistema de audio en Linux. En el corazón, encontramos ALSA (Advanced Linux Sound Architecture), que es la capa de bajo nivel que interactúa directamente con el hardware de tu tarjeta de sonido. ALSA proporciona los controladores (drivers) que permiten al kernel de Linux comunicarse con el chip de audio. Sobre ALSA, generalmente, se encuentra PulseAudio, un servidor de sonido que gestiona la mezcla de audio de múltiples aplicaciones y la enruta a los dispositivos de salida. PulseAudio ofrece características avanzadas como el control de volumen por aplicación, la redirección de audio a dispositivos remotos y una gestión más flexible de las entradas y salidas de sonido. Un problema en cualquiera de estas capas puede resultar en la temida falta de sonido.
Primeros Auxilios: Comprobaciones Básicas e Indispensables 🔊
Antes de embarcarte en soluciones más complejas, asegúrate de haber cubierto los puntos fundamentales. Muchas veces, la respuesta está en lo más simple:
- Niveles de Volumen: Parece obvio, pero verifica tanto el volumen maestro del sistema como el de las aplicaciones individuales (navegador, reproductor de medios). A veces, una aplicación silenciada es la única culpable.
- Conexiones Físicas: Asegúrate de que tus altavoces o auriculares estén correctamente enchufados en la toma de audio adecuada. Prueba con otros dispositivos de sonido para descartar un fallo de hardware externo.
- Salida Silenciada: En el panel de sonido de Ubuntu (accesible desde el icono de volumen en la barra superior), asegúrate de que el dispositivo de salida correcto esté seleccionado y que no esté silenciado.
- Reiniciar el Sistema: Un reinicio simple puede resolver problemas temporales del subsistema de audio que se hayan quedado „enganchados”.
Inmersión Profunda: Problemas de Software y su Resolución 🛠️
Si las comprobaciones iniciales no han restaurado el sonido, es probable que el inconveniente resida en la configuración o los paquetes de software. Aquí abordaremos las soluciones más comunes y efectivas:
El Dominio de PulseAudio: Tu Servidor de Sonido
PulseAudio es a menudo el punto donde se originan muchos problemas de sonido, pero también donde se encuentran muchas soluciones.
- Restablecer la Configuración de PulseAudio:
Los archivos de configuración corruptos o mal ajustados pueden generar fallas. Eliminar la configuración del usuario y reiniciar PulseAudio puede ser muy efectivo. Abre una terminal (Ctrl+Alt+T) y ejecuta:
rm -r ~/.config/pulse
Luego, reinicia el servicio o tu sesión de usuario:
pulseaudio -k && pulseaudio --start
Si esto no funciona inmediatamente, prueba con un reinicio completo del sistema.
- Reinstalación Completa de PulseAudio:
Si el restablecimiento no funcionó, los paquetes de PulseAudio podrían estar dañados. Una reinstalación es la siguiente opción. Primero, purga los paquetes existentes y sus configuraciones:
sudo apt-get purge pulseaudio pulseaudio-utils gstreamer0.10-pulseaudio padevchooser pavucontrol
Después de purgar, vuelve a instalarlos:
sudo apt-get install pulseaudio pulseaudio-utils gstreamer0.10-pulseaudio padevchooser pavucontrol
Una vez completado, reinicia tu sistema.
- Uso de Pavucontrol (Control de Volumen de PulseAudio):
Esta es una herramienta gráfica indispensable para gestionar PulseAudio. Si no la tienes instalada (debería venir con la reinstalación anterior), hazlo con:
sudo apt-get install pavucontrol
Luego, ejecuta
pavucontrol
desde la terminal o desde el Dash. En sus diferentes pestañas (Reproducción, Dispositivos de Salida, Dispositivos de Entrada, Configuración), puedes:- Asegurarte de que el dispositivo de salida correcto esté seleccionado.
- Verificar que ningún canal esté silenciado.
- Ajustar los perfiles de configuración de tu tarjeta de sonido (por ejemplo, Estéreo analógico Dúplex).
La Base de ALSA: La Arquitectura Fundamental
Si PulseAudio no era el inconveniente, quizás la raíz del problema se encuentre en ALSA.
- Comprobar alsamixer:
Esta es la interfaz de mezclador de audio de ALSA en la terminal. Abre una terminal y escribe:
alsamixer
Verás una interfaz donde puedes controlar los diferentes canales de sonido. Asegúrate de que nada esté silenciado (indicado por „MM”) y que los niveles de volumen estén adecuados. Utiliza las teclas de flecha para navegar y ‘M’ para activar/desactivar el silencio.
- Reinstalar ALSA:
Similar a PulseAudio, los paquetes de ALSA pueden corromperse. Reinstálalos con:
sudo apt-get remove --purge alsa-base alsa-utils
sudo apt-get install alsa-base alsa-utils
Luego, recarga los módulos de ALSA:
sudo alsa force-reload
Un reinicio del sistema es recomendable después de esto.
Actualizaciones del Sistema: Manteniendo tu Precise Pangolin al Día
Aunque Ubuntu 12.04 LTS-2 es una versión antigua, seguir recibiendo actualizaciones de seguridad y correcciones de errores es vital. Asegúrate de que tu sistema esté completamente actualizado:
sudo apt-get update && sudo apt-get upgrade && sudo apt-get dist-upgrade
Esto puede resolver dependencias rotas o actualizar componentes clave que afecten al audio.
Cuando los Controladores Hablan: Problemas de Hardware y Firmware 💡
A veces, el software está bien, pero el sistema no puede comunicarse correctamente con tu hardware de sonido. Aquí es donde los controladores (módulos del kernel) entran en juego.
- Identificación del Chip de Audio:
Conocer tu hardware de sonido es el primer paso. En la terminal, ejecuta:
lspci -v | grep -A7 -i audio
Esto te mostrará detalles sobre tu controlador de audio (por ejemplo, Realtek, Intel HDA). Esta información puede ser útil para buscar soluciones específicas en foros o documentaciones.
- Reinstalación y Recarga de Módulos del Kernel (Controladores ALSA):
El sistema de audio se compone de varios módulos del kernel. Puedes intentar recargarlos. Primero, verifica qué módulos de sonido están activos:
lsmod | grep snd
Luego, intenta recargarlos. Esto es delicado y requiere cuidado:
sudo modprobe -r
# Ejemplo: sudo modprobe -r snd_hda_intel sudo modprobe
También puedes intentar reinstalar paquetes relacionados con el sonido y el kernel:
sudo apt-get install linux-sound-base oss-compat
- Conflicto de Módulos (Blacklisting):
En ocasiones, dos módulos intentan controlar la misma tarjeta de sonido o un módulo genérico interfiere con uno específico. Puedes intentar „poner en la lista negra” (blacklist) módulos problemáticos. Si sospechas de un módulo, puedes añadirlo al archivo de configuración:
sudo nano /etc/modprobe.d/blacklist.conf
Añade una línea como:
blacklist
# Ejemplo: blacklist pcspkr Guarda y cierra el archivo, luego reinicia. (Nota: siempre haz una copia de seguridad de los archivos antes de editarlos).
- Verificación de la BIOS/UEFI:
Aunque es menos común, algunos sistemas tienen la opción de deshabilitar la tarjeta de sonido a nivel de firmware. Reinicia tu ordenador y entra en la configuración de la BIOS/UEFI (normalmente pulsando Del, F2, F10 o F12 durante el arranque). Busca opciones relacionadas con „Audio”, „Sound Card” o „Integrated Peripherals” y asegúrate de que esté habilitada.
Diagnóstico Avanzado y Escenarios Específicos ⚠️
Si has llegado hasta aquí y el sonido sigue sin aparecer, es momento de un diagnóstico más exhaustivo.
- Archivos de Registro del Sistema: Los registros pueden contener pistas valiosas.
dmesg
muestra mensajes del kernel. Busca „audio”, „sound”, „ALSA”, „HDA” para identificar errores de hardware o controladores./var/log/syslog
contiene mensajes más generales del sistema.
Busca líneas que indiquen fallos, advertencias o dispositivos no encontrados.
- Crear un Nuevo Perfil de Usuario: A veces, la corrupción de la configuración es específica de tu cuenta de usuario. Crea un nuevo usuario y comprueba si el sonido funciona en esa cuenta. Si es así, el problema está en tu perfil original.
- Probar con una Versión Live de Ubuntu: Arranca tu ordenador con una Live USB o CD de Ubuntu (puede ser incluso una versión más reciente, si tienes una a mano). Si el sonido funciona en el entorno Live, esto descarta un problema de hardware y confirma que la falla está en tu instalación actual de 12.04.
- Problemas con Aplicaciones Específicas: Si el sonido funciona en general pero no en una aplicación particular (por ejemplo, un navegador web con Flash o HTML5), el problema podría estar en los códecs o complementos de esa aplicación.
Reflexión Basada en Datos y mi Perspectiva 📈
El subsistema de sonido en Linux ha experimentado una evolución considerable desde los días de Ubuntu 12.04. Las distribuciones más modernas han pulido la integración entre ALSA y PulseAudio, y en algunos casos, han empezado a mirar hacia tecnologías más nuevas como PipeWire para un manejo aún más eficiente del audio y el video. Ubuntu 12.04 LTS-2 fue, en su momento, un pilar de estabilidad y una puerta de entrada para muchos al mundo Linux. Su soporte a largo plazo fue crucial para su adopción generalizada, pero también presenta desafíos cuando se trata de compatibilidad con hardware lanzado mucho después de su desarrollo inicial o cuando surgen errores específicos que, con el tiempo, dejan de ser prioritarios para los desarrolladores de las versiones actuales.
Desde mi perspectiva, la persistencia de problemas de audio en sistemas antiguos como Precise Pangolin a menudo se debe a la interacción de controladores de hardware específicos que no se han mantenido a la par con el kernel Linux más reciente, o a configuraciones de PulseAudio que pueden volverse problemáticas después de ciertas actualizaciones. La riqueza de opciones en el ecosistema de sonido de Linux, aunque poderosa, también puede ser una fuente de confusión.
„La durabilidad de una distribución LTS es un arma de doble filo: ofrece una estabilidad inigualable, pero también puede ser un desafío cuando se trata de la compatibilidad con las tecnologías más recientes o cuando surgen errores específicos que, con el tiempo, dejan de ser prioritarios para los desarrolladores de las versiones actuales.”
En esencia, solucionar estos inconvenientes es un ejercicio de arqueología digital, donde la paciencia y un enfoque metódico son tus mejores aliados. Los datos demuestran que la mayoría de los problemas de sonido en Linux, incluso en versiones más antiguas, son solucionables a nivel de software. La clave reside en identificar la capa correcta (ALSA, PulseAudio, controladores) donde se origina la anomalía y aplicar la corrección pertinente.
Conclusión: ¡No te rindas! ✅
Recuperar el sonido en tu Ubuntu 12.04 LTS-2 puede requerir algo de esfuerzo, pero como has visto, existen numerosas estrategias para abordar el inconveniente. Desde las comprobaciones más elementales hasta la reinstalación de componentes cruciales o el ajuste fino de los controladores, hemos cubierto un espectro amplio de soluciones. Lo más importante es proceder con paciencia, siguiendo los pasos de forma metódica y observando los resultados.
Espero que esta guía te haya proporcionado las herramientas y la confianza necesarias para superar este desafío y devolver la banda sonora a tu experiencia en Precise Pangolin. Recuerda que la comunidad Linux es vasta y siempre dispuesta a ayudar. Si después de seguir estos pasos el problema persiste, no dudes en buscar en foros específicos de Ubuntu, proporcionando tantos detalles como sea posible sobre tu hardware y los pasos que ya has intentado. ¡Que el silencio no te venza!